Placed them in a clothes dryer on the highest warm setting for 30 minutes. Make use of a cleaner on cushions, couches, and various other places where insects conceal. Leave ravaged products in black bags and leave them outside on a hot day that reaches 120F (49C) or in a shut automobile for at the very least 90 mins.


Put bags consisting of bedbugs in the freezer at 0F (-19 C). Use a thermostat to check the temperature. Leave them in there for a minimum of 4 days. As soon as you have actually cleansed all noticeable vermins, make the location inhospitable for the remainder of them. Place bedbug-proof covers over your mattress and box spring.

Without this finishing, the bugs dry and die. 2 examples of desiccants are silica aerogel (Tri-Die and CimeXa) and diatomaceous planet. The advantage of desiccants is that bedbugs can not become immune to them, but they work slowly. These products can take a few months to exterminate all the pests.


Inspect the ravaged areas regarding as soon as every seven days for signs of activity. To make enduring vermins easier to find, area insect interceptors under each leg of the bed. These devices will trap bedbugs prior to they can climb up into your bed. You may need to keep checking the interceptors for a complete year.


Simply when you assume you've cleaned them out, you could detect them once more. You might need to try a couple of various therapy techniques to regulate the infestation. And if they still do not go away, you'll wish to employ an expert pest control specialist. If you can not eliminate bedbugs by yourself, it's time to obtain the pros entailed.

They have insecticides that both kill pests on contact which stay inside furnishings and cracks to kill insects in the long term. Parasite control firms can likewise use whole-room warmth treatments - Chicago Bed Bug Exterminator. They generate special tools that heats up the area to 135 and 145F (57.22 and 62.78 C), which is hot enough to kill insects




Follow their instructions meticulously and you'll have the ideal chance of erasing the pests. Expert therapies take a couple of visits to start functioning. After each treatment, you might need to stay out of the treated spaces for a couple of hours until the insecticides have actually dried.

The female bed pest will certainly lay one to five eggs each day and in between 200 and 500 in her life. Bed bug eggs are white and oval-shaped, article source typically put in cracks and gaps. It takes concerning one week for bed insect eggs to hatch out. Once hatched, the nymph will certainly lose no time looking for a blood meal to start feeding.


Once the bed insect has actually gone via check it out 2 molts, it ends up being a Third phase fairy and standards around 2.5 mm long. Bed bugs can live up to a year, nonetheless the typical life-span of a bed bug is around 10 months with adequate food supply and constant area temperature level.
